Your Mission:
In this role, the Indirect Tax Analyst provides tax expertise related to U.S. and international indirect tax matters for Little Caesars, Blue Line, and other related business entities. This role is responsible for tax research, compliance, audits, and communication of tax developments. The position will also support tax-related technology implementations, including Vertex integrations to Caesar Vision (cloud-based Point of Sale software) and Oracle ERP, and provide guidance on tax implications for business operations.
How You’ll Make an Impact:
- Prepare, review, and file U.S. Sales & Use Tax, Gross Receipts, B&O Tax, Canadian GST/HST/PST/QST, and other indirect tax returns.
- Research taxability of products, services, and transactions across various jurisdictions and provide guidance to internal and external stakeholders.
- Register entities for Sales & Use Tax, VAT, GST/HST, PST, and other indirect taxes as needed.
- Audit customer tax exemptions annually and request renewals when necessary.
- Draft tax memoranda related to indirect tax positions and compliance matters.
- Assist with sales and use tax audits by providing necessary reports, tax mapping details, and compliance documentation.
- Act as a liaison with external tax consultants, attorneys, and tax authorities to resolve tax discrepancies and ensure compliance.
- Provide tax support to franchisees, including POS taxation, taxability of billings, and other related concerns.
- Oversee and support the implementation of indirect tax technology solutions, including Vertex OSeries with Oracle ERP and Caesar Vision POS, ensuring tax settings and rates comply with jurisdictional rules.
- Address tax discrepancies in Vertex, coordinate with internal teams and vendors, and document issues and resolutions for audit purposes.
- Provide guidance on jurisdictional tax requirements, including regulatory licenses, receipts, and tax invoice presentation.
- Support the tax department with special projects, including research on tax implications for new business initiatives (e.g., fundraising, marketplace delivery, cross-border sales, not-for-profit ventures).
- Ensure compliance with special taxes such as restaurant, hospitality, and tourism taxes that impact the Quick Service Restaurant industry.
- Collaborate with internal teams to develop reports and ensure tax-related business requirements are met.

ABOUT LITTLE CAESARS®
Headquartered in Detroit, Michigan, Little Caesars was founded by Mike and Marian Ilitch in 1959 as a single, family-owned restaurant. Today, Little Caesars is the third largest pizza chain in the world, with stores in each of the 50 U.S. states and 27 countries and territories.
Little Caesars recently introduced contactless options for both delivery and carry-out through the Little Caesars app. Pizzas are baked in 475-degree ovens to ensure food safety and never touched after baking. The chain has also reinforced cleanliness and sanitization procedures, increasing the frequency of cleaning commonly touched surfaces including door handles, glass, countertops, Pizza Portal surfaces, phones, and cash registers.
Known for its HOT-N-READY® pizza and famed Crazy Bread®, Little Caesars has been named “Best Value in America” for the past twelve years (based on nationwide survey of national quick service restaurant customers conducted by Sandelman & Associates - 2007-2019 entitled “Highest Rated Chain – Value for the Money”). Little Caesars products are made with quality ingredients, like fresh, never frozen, mozzarella and Muenster cheese and sauce made from fresh-packed, vine-ripened California crushed tomatoes.
